Understand Your Business Needs

Firstly, it’s important to understand your specific needs. The type of goods you need to store, their volume, and the required temperature range will dictate the kind of refrigeration system you require. For instance, a restaurant might need a different setup compared to a grocery store or a pharmaceutical company.

Evaluate Different Types of Refrigeration Systems

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, it’s time to evaluate the various types of refrigeration systems available. These include walk-in coolers, reach-in refrigerators, and refrigerated display cases, among others. Each type has its advantages and disadvantages, so consider your space, budget, and specific requirements when making a choice.

Consider Energy Efficiency

It is another critical factor to consider. While the upfront cost of an energy-efficient model might be higher, it can save you a significant amount in the long run through reduced energy bills. Look for models with energy star ratings and consider investing in a system with modern features like digital temperature control and automatic defrost.

Maintenance and Repair

They both are often overlooked but are crucial aspects of selecting a commercial refrigeration system. Choose a model from a reputable manufacturer that offers good after-sales service. Regular maintenance can extend the lifespan of your equipment and prevent costly repairs down the line.

Farm Refrigeration

For businesses in the agricultural sector, choosing the right farm refrigeration in Hamilton is paramount. These units differ from standard commercial refrigeration systems as they need to maintain the freshness of produce straight from the field. When selecting a refrigerator for your farm, consider factors such as humidity control, temperature consistency, and the ability to handle large volumes of produce.
